## Configuration

The autocomplete index in Quillsearch rebuilds incrementally, but the first full build on a fresh checkout is slow — expect 20–40 minutes on the Harrowgate dataset. You can trim this by setting `QS_INDEX_SHARDS` lower during development; production keeps the default. All settings live in `quillsearch.env` next to the binary. The indexer authenticates against the catalog service before it can stream documents, so the env file must carry its access credential on the line immediately following.

secret setting of yagap-fadup: ARCHIVE_KEY3=8b1

- [ ] **Step 7: Breaker override escrow.** After sealing the signing keys for the Tallgrove upstream API circuit breaker, confirm the support team can force the breaker open during a full outage. The override bundle lives in the sealed escrow drawer and is useless without its unlock phrase. Two ceremony witnesses must initial this step before proceeding. The escrow bundle is decrypted with the recovery passphrase that follows.

vault phrase of kahip-kahop = holath-quenmir

Runbook: Scanline barcode bridge

If warehouse scans stop flowing into Cartwheel, it's almost always the bridge service on the Dunmore floor box wedging after a USB hiccup. Bounce the service first — nine times out of ten that fixes it. If not, check the queue depth before escalating. When restarting, make sure the bridge comes up with these settings.

deployment values, yafop-bajef:
[gilok]
team = ulaius
access_code = ac_423664
host = gilok.sivrelhq.corp
port = 9200
owner = pelius.istax
peer = eliok.torvasoft.internal

Finance Review Summary — Hiring Freeze, Instrumentation Division

For the board of Taverholm Industries. Effective next quarter, all open requisitions in the Instrumentation Division are suspended pending the annual cost review. Critical safety roles at the Brindle Lake plant are exempt, subject to CFO approval. Attrition will not be backfilled during the freeze window. Headcount impact is estimated at eleven positions. The connected strategic considerations appear in the note below.

board note of kafog-bajep: Briathek Partners is in early talks to buy Aldaelek Group for about $47.1 million. The Ulaath launch date is September 4, and nothing goes to the press before then.